首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

查询收藏列表的最佳方法

可以通过使用数据库来实现。数据库是一种用于存储和管理数据的软件系统,可以提供高效的数据查询和存储功能。

在云计算领域,常用的数据库类型包括关系型数据库和非关系型数据库。关系型数据库使用表格来组织数据,具有严格的结构和关系,适用于需要保持数据一致性和完整性的场景。非关系型数据库则以键值对、文档、列族等形式存储数据,适用于需要高可扩展性和灵活性的场景。

对于查询收藏列表的最佳方法,可以考虑以下几个方面:

  1. 数据库选择:根据具体需求选择合适的数据库类型。如果收藏列表的数据结构相对简单且需要高效的查询,可以选择关系型数据库,如MySQL、PostgreSQL等。如果数据结构复杂或需要高可扩展性,可以选择非关系型数据库,如MongoDB、Redis等。
  2. 数据库设计:根据收藏列表的数据结构设计数据库表或集合。可以创建一个包含用户ID、收藏项ID、收藏时间等字段的表或集合,用于存储用户的收藏信息。
  3. 查询语句编写:使用数据库查询语言(如SQL)编写查询语句。可以根据具体需求查询用户的收藏列表,如按照用户ID查询、按照收藏时间排序等。
  4. 索引优化:对于大规模的数据集,可以创建索引来提高查询性能。索引可以加快数据的查找速度,常见的索引类型包括主键索引、唯一索引、普通索引等。
  5. 数据库缓存:为了进一步提高查询性能,可以使用缓存技术。将查询结果缓存到内存中,下次查询时可以直接从缓存中获取,减少数据库的访问次数。

腾讯云提供了多种数据库产品和服务,可以根据具体需求选择合适的产品。例如,腾讯云的云数据库 MySQL(https://cloud.tencent.com/product/cdb_mysql)和云数据库 Redis(https://cloud.tencent.com/product/cdb_redis)提供了高性能、高可用的数据库服务,适用于各种应用场景。

总结:查询收藏列表的最佳方法是选择合适的数据库类型,设计合理的数据库结构,编写高效的查询语句,并结合索引和缓存技术来提高查询性能。腾讯云提供了多种数据库产品和服务,可以根据具体需求选择合适的产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券